Yes. Sugar has plenty of calories, but they're "empty calories" with no nutritional value for your baby. Eating and drinking too many foods and beverages with added sugars is tied to chronic diseases such as obesity, diabetes, and heart disease. Even as your child gets older, it's best to limit sugar. The new guidelines call for less than 25 grams (6 teaspoons) of sugar per day for children ages 2 to 18 years. That includes no more than 8 ounces of sugar-sweetened drinks per week. “Children younger than 2 years should have no sugar at all,” adds Dr.

WebFeb 25, 2024 · For example, some foods that are served uncooked, whole, or in certain shapes or sizes can be choking hazards. Cutting up food into smaller pieces and mashing foods can help prevent choking.
